Recessed Light Replacement in Alpharetta, GA
Recessed light replacement services involve upgrading or swapping out existing installed ceiling lights to improve illumination, energy efficiency, or aesthetic appeal within a property. This project typically covers areas such as living rooms, kitchens, hallways, and bathrooms, where recessed lighting fixtures are a common choice for a clean, modern look. Homeowners often request this service when fixtures become outdated, damaged, or when upgrading to newer models that offer better lighting quality or energy savings.
Before requesting recessed light repl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the work, including whether electrical connections need to be modified or if new fixtures require additional installation work. It's also helpful to know the types of fixtures available, such as LED or dimmable options, and whether existing ceiling openings are compatible with new designs. Clarifying these details can ensure the replacement process aligns with the property's lighting goals and any necessary adjustments are properly planned.

Recessed Light Replacement Questions
What are recessed light replacements used for? They update outdated or damaged lighting fixtures and improve energy efficiency in homes and properties.
Can recessed lights be replaced in existing ceilings? Yes, they can be replaced in most existing ceiling setups, often with minimal disruption.
Is it necessary to upgrade wiring during a recessed light replacement? Not always, but older wiring may need inspection or upgrades for safety and compatibility.
What should property owners consider before replacing recessed lights? Compatibility with existing fixtures, ceiling type, and desired lighting effects are key considerations.
